K885141 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the EMIT THYROXINE ASSAY. Classified as Enzyme Immunoassay, Non-radiolabeled, Total Thyroxine (product code KLI),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Syva Co. (Palo Alto,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on February 17, 1989 after a review of 64 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Chemistry F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 862.1700 - the FDA in vitro diagnostics and chemistry fram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
